The communist mayor of New York, Zohran Mamdani, publicly spoke about the match between Argentina and Egypt in the round of 16 of the 2026 World Cup, claiming without any evidence that the African team was "robbed" in the result.

During an official speech focused on public transportation issues in New York, the mayor introduced a football reference that quickly went viral.

In that context, he stated: "If you take the bus to work, the savings are considerable. In six months, you will have spent 24 hours less on the bus. After a year, you will have saved more than two days of commuting. That means having breakfast with your family."

He added: "It means having time to discuss balls and strikes in your child's little league baseball game. It means getting home in time for bedtime. It means agreeing with your friends that Egypt was robbed yesterday", repeating the unfounded accusations that emerged from various anti-Argentina sectors.

The statements did not go unnoticed, especially considering he is an active political figure in an institutional setting.

This is a mayor who was born in Kampala, the capital of Uganda, and became the first immigrant and Muslim mayor of New York.

The match that sparked the controversy took place at the Atlanta Stadium and had a dramatic outcome. Egypt was leading 2-0, but Argentina managed to turn the score around in the last 13 minutes to win 3-2.

The goals for the South American team were scored by Cristian Romero, Lionel Messi, and Enzo Fernández, in a comeback that secured their qualification for the next stage of the tournament.

The result generated strong reactions in the Egyptian environment, with criticisms of the refereeing and allegations of supposed irregularities during the game.
